1. What is AnswerConnect?
AnswerConnect is a live human answering service, founded in 2002, with agents trained on insurance terminology and dedicated solutions for brokers and claims adjusters. It covers phone, email, and web chat 24/7 across the US, UK, and Canada. Integration is CRM-via-Zapier rather than native, so messages are relayed for your team to enter.
2. Who uses AnswerConnect?
AnswerConnect’s public materials describe a multi-industry buyer with an insurance specialization - insurance brokers, claims adjusters, and SMBs. The typical user wants insurance-aware humans answering the phone around the clock without hiring, and is comfortable with relayed messages rather than automatic system updates.
3. How much does AnswerConnect cost?
AnswerConnect uses per-minute pricing; its published plans start around $325/month for a base block of minutes. As with any per-minute service, cost rises with call volume, so model your real monthly minutes before comparing - and confirm the current rate card, since published figures change. 5. How long does it take to implement AnswerConnect?
AnswerConnect offers self-service setup with support - you provide scripts and routing preferences and the service goes live without equipment. Setup is quick; the ongoing consideration is the relay workflow, where every message is keyed into your AMS by hand, and the per-minute cost as volume grows.
6. What does AnswerConnect integrate with?
AnswerConnect connects to general business tools - Salesforce, HubSpot - via Zapier (8,000+ apps). It does not list native connectors for retail P&C agency management systems, so calls are relayed rather than written into EZLynx, Applied Epic, HawkSoft, or AMS360 automatically. See why native AMS write-back changes the workflow.
7. Compliance and security
AnswerConnect does not publicly document SOC 2 or similar certifications. For an agency handling policyholder data, that’s worth confirming directly - and it’s a difference from vendors that publish a SOC 2 report you can rely on in a security review.
